Embrace Fall Pest Control Services in Central and Southern Maryland The copper mesh deters mice because they don’t like it and won’t take the effort to try and chew through it. ![]() In these cases, Natural Green recommends copper mesh and expanding foam. Once you get to openings between one-quarter inch and 1 inch in diameter, you want something more secure, especially when it comes to keeping rodents out. ![]() Up to one-quarter inch, you can use caulk to seal holes. But as the temperatures begin to drop, they start to seek shelter in warmer places. This means they are still moving about in fall. Pests are active anytime daytime temperatures are above 50 degrees Fahrenheit. In fact, they can sneak into the tiniest of holes located between walls, below floors, in attics, inside potted plants, under your siding, around your home foundation or window and door frames, and near basements, window wells, and insulation. Rodents and pests don’t need a big, grand entryway. Knowing where they like to find their ways inside can help you identify your focal points for stopping them in their tracks.
